Output 2859d82d9137c9ae23f2d2afed4ce6876e945461dec1049c8c828ab68a36d625:3

value
1330488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7da3adbbe83df4b54d8d2500818b1aa8b6f2851 OP_EQUAL
address
3QHYFoiPBHRMaNuKgxZNdek4o7hHFVR9AX
transaction
2859d82d9137c9ae23f2d2afed4ce6876e945461dec1049c8c828ab68a36d625
spent
true